South Africa’s ANC Withdraws Land Expropriation Bill of 2016
By:
Wed, 29 Aug 2018 || South Africa,
South Africa’s ruling African National Congress (ANC) on Tuesday announced the withdrawal of the expropriation bill passed by parliament in 2016 enabling the state to make compulsory purchases of land to redress racial disparities in land ownership has been withdrawn.
The bill which had not been signed into law was withdrawn to allow an ongoing process that could lead to the changing of the constitution to pave way for the expropriation of land without compensation, the party said.
